Stage 5: Evaluate and Analyze Results


During release review, the development, test, and program management teams meet to discuss whether to release the implementation. If this review is successful, the product is released to production. Otherwise, the outstanding issues are reviewed and fixed.

In addition to reports that summarize and evaluate the test results, it is recommended that the release review include the following:

  • Best practices for executing the test cases

  • Root-cause analysis for the defects found in the testing process

  • Identification and discussion of any areas in the migrated application that need further improvement or retesting
